Question from Australia:
I have type�1 diabetes, and I am taking Mixtard insulin and have been adding more Actrapid to it. How long can I keep the pre-mixed insulin in the same vial? I would like to try NovoRapid with Mixtard. Would this be okay? How long can I keep it in the same vial?
Answer:
I read your letter and thought about it many times before arriving at the decision that nowadays is no longer ethical for us as diabetologists not to try to advise people with type�1 to leave the premixed regimen, especially if you add Regular or any analog (Humalog or Novorapid), and switch to an intensified basal/bolus insulin regimen. Ask your diabetes team for further help. I hope you will make the change soon.
If you add short-acting insulin to the pre-mix, you should inject the ‘de novo’ mixture as soon as you mix up the two components.
